Some routine red blood cell (RBC) measurements and indexes (count, mean volume, volume dispersion, and mean hemoglobin [HGB] concentration) can be used to differentiate iron deficiency from heterozygous beta-thalassemia. A number of formulas that incorporate two or more of these measurements have been described to amplify such differences. The H*1 hematology analyzer directly measures volume and HGB concentration of individual RBCs. We have assessed the diagnostic usefulness of conventional and new RBC measurements provided by the H*1 on a learning data set that comprised 119 patients with iron deficiency and 172 patients with beta-thalassemia trait, both untreated and uncomplicated. The most striking finding was the inverse behavior of percentages of microcytes (volume, less than 60 fL) and hypochromic RBCs (HGB concentration, less than 280 g/L) in the two conditions. In 162 of 172 patients with beta-thalassemia trait, the percentage of microcytes (mean, 33.1%; central 95th percentile range, 9.2% to 54.5%) was higher than the percentage of hypochromic RBCs (mean, 13.9%; central 95th percentile range, 1.7% to 24.7%). In 105 of 119 patients with iron deficiency, on the contrary, the percentage of hypochromic cells (mean, 34.6%; central 95th percentile range, 9.7% to 73.1%) was higher than the percentage of microcytes (mean, 12.8%; central 95th percentile range, 1.7% to 29.6%). The ratio between the percentage of microcytes and the percentage of hypochromic cells provided by the H*1 (microcytic-hypochromic ratio) was useful in differentiating the two types of
microcytic anemia
: with the use of a discriminant value of 0.9, the discriminant efficiency of the microcytic-hypochromic ratio was 92.4% (95% confidence interval, 88.8% to 95.2%), higher than that of the five previously described discriminant formulas and simple RBC measurements. When assessed on a test data set that comprised 149 unselected cases of
microcytic anemia
, a microcytic-hypochromic ratio lower than 0.9 demonstrated high sensitivity (94.0%), specificity (92.3%), and predictive value (94.0%) for the presence of iron-deficient erythropoiesis in patients with isolated iron deficiency,
polycythemia vera
treated by phlebotomy, and iron deficiency complicating heterozygous thalassemia. In conclusion, our results showed that iron-deficient erythropoiesis is characterized by the production of RBCs with a severely decreased HGB concentration, while microcytes of beta-thalassemia trait are generally smaller, with a more preserved HGB concentration. Such properties, as assessed by the H*1 hematology analyzer, are very useful in distinguishing these two common types of
microcytic anemia
.

A 77-year-old male having multiple small nevi over the lips, face, mucous membrane of mouth, tongue, neck and thorax was admitted to our hospital because of severe anemia. He has been diagnosed as Rendu-Osler-Weber disease (
Osler's disease
) since his 42 years of age. Although the stools were positive for occult blood, hematologic examination disclosed no abnormalities except for severe hypochromic and
microcytic anemia
. Gastrointestinal examination showed multiple stigmata in the esophagus, stomach, duodenum, and several tumors in the colon. Histological findings of biopsy specimens obtained from these tumors revealed adenocarcinomas and tubular adenomas. Surgical resection was carried out. Resected specimens showed two tumors (one is in ascending colon appeared to be 2 type carcinoma, 1.9 x 2.3 cm in size, another is in caecum, 3 type, 7.0 x 5.0 cm in size) and three Yamada-II approximately III type polyps. Pathohistologically, the tumor in ascending colon showed moderately differentiated adenocarcinoma, another one in caecum showed mucinous carcinoma, and polyps showed tubular adenomas, respectively. Unfortunately, the anemia of this case was regarded as stemming from
Osler's disease
, so the precise gastrointestinal examination was not performed for a long time. It should be emphasized to be faithful to the fundamentals of medical diagnosis.

Criteria proposed by the
Polycythemia Vera
Study Group (PVSG) as well as several derived algorithms are currently used for the diagnosis of
polycythemia vera
. Although these guidelines have significantly enhanced diagnostic accuracy, they uniformly consider erythrocytosis as the requisite premise for instigating the subsequent workup. We describe the unusual presentation of a patient with
microcytic anemia
in whom the diagnosis of
polycythemia vera
was reached using the PVSG criteria and confirmed by in vitro culture assay of erythroid progenitor cells. This case highlights the usefulness of the PVSG criteria, including the red cell mass determination, for the diagnosis of
polycythemia vera
even in anemic patients. The roles of spleen red cell pooling and plasma volume expansion as major determinants of this unusual presentation are discussed.
